Soft closing toilet seats have become a common feature in modern bathrooms.
Unlike traditional toilet seats that can slam shut loudly, a soft closing toilet seat lowers slowly and quietly, creating a smoother and more comfortable user experience.
But how do soft closing toilet seats work?
The answer lies in a soft close mechanism installed inside the soft close toilet seat hinges. These hinges contain internal damping components that control the speed of the seat and lid, allowing them to close smoothly without sudden impact.

From the outside, this component is usually invisible because it is built into the hinge structure. However, it plays a crucial role in controlling the closing motion of the seat.
A rotary damper is an industrial component designed to control motion speed. Inside the damper, specially designed internal structures and damping oil create controlled resistance during movement.
When the toilet seat begins to close, the hinge rotates and activates the rotary damper. The kinetic energy generated by the falling lid is gradually absorbed by the internal fluid resistance of the damper. As a result, the soft close hinge mechanism slows down the movement, allowing the seat to close gently and quietly.
To achieve the soft closing function, most toilet seats rely on a soft close toilet seat hinge system consisting of several key components.
The hinge body connects the toilet seat to the toilet bowl and provides the structural support for installing the internal damping mechanism.
The rotary damper is the core component responsible for controlling the closing speed. It regulates the motion of the seat so that it descends slowly and smoothly.
The mounting base secures the entire soft close toilet seat hinge system firmly to the ceramic toilet bowl, ensuring long-term stability and reliable operation.
In actual product design, different toilet manufacturers may modify the structure, layout, or appearance of these components to match their product design, space limitations, and user experience requirements.
Soft close toilet seat hinges can be designed in several different forms depending on the structure of the toilet seat and the installation method.
Except for some built-in or specially designed hinge structures that are not intended to be replaced by users, the most common types include top-fix hinges, bottom-fix hinges, and quick-release soft close hinges.
· Top-fix hinges are installed from the top of the toilet bowl and are commonly used in modern bathroom designs.
· Bottom-fix hinges are secured from underneath the bowl and are more commonly found in traditional toilet seat designs.
· Some manufacturers also offer quick-release soft close toilet seat hinges, which allow users to easily remove the seat for cleaning.
Different hinge structures may use slightly different soft close mechanisms, but most designs rely on an internal rotary damper to control the closing speed.
As consumers place greater emphasis on comfort and product quality, soft closing toilet seats have become increasingly popular in modern bathrooms.
One of the biggest advantages is noise reduction. The controlled closing motion prevents the lid from slamming, making the bathroom environment quieter and more comfortable.
Another benefit is improved safety. Because the seat closes slowly, the risk of finger pinching caused by sudden falling is greatly reduced.
In addition, the reduced impact during closing helps minimize wear on the seat and hinges, improving the durability of the product over time.

A soft close toilet seat closes slowly because a rotary damper inside the hinge controls the motion. When the lid moves downward, the damper creates fluid resistance that slows the movement and prevents the seat from slamming shut.
If a soft close toilet seat is not working properly, it is often due to wear or aging of the internal damping components. Over time, the damping oil or sealing structure inside the rotary damper may degrade, reducing its ability to control motion. In many cases, replacing the soft close toilet seat hinges will restore the soft closing function.
Whether a soft close toilet seat can be repaired depends on its design. Some toilet seats use replaceable rotary dampers that can be serviced individually. However, many designs integrate the damper directly into the hinge assembly, which means the entire soft close toilet seat hinge may need to be replaced.
